Cheapest Mercer Island Home Now $1.23 Million
To put it another way, this house costs $300,000 per bedroom.
MERCER ISLAND, WA - The Mercer Island housing market saw a little dip earlier this fall when the cheapest house on the island dipped to just $900,000, according to Realtor.com listings.
Well, the market's back.
The cheapest home for sale on the island right now is $1.23 million. It's a nice home, but it would probably sell for much, much, much less if it were in, say, North Bend or even Seattle. It doesn't even come with much of a Lake Washington view.
